Вопросы с тегом «string»

151
Без учета регистра 'in'

Я люблю использовать выражение if 'MICHAEL89' in USERNAMES: ... где USERNAMESсписок. Есть ли способ сопоставить элементы с нечувствительностью к регистру или мне нужно использовать собственный метод? Просто интересно, есть ли необходимость писать дополнительный код для...

151
Конвертировать HTML в NSAttributedString в iOS

Я использую экземпляр UIWebViewдля обработки некоторого текста и его правильного цвета, он дает результат в виде HTML, но вместо того, чтобы отображать его в виде, который UIWebViewя хочу отобразить, используя Core Textс NSAttributedString. Я могу создавать и рисовать, NSAttributedStringно я не...

151
Разница между нулевой и пустой («») строкой Java

В чем разница между nullи ""(пустая строка)? Я написал простой код: String a = ""; String b = null; System.out.println(a == b); // false System.out.println(a.equals(b)); // false Оба утверждения возвращаются false. Кажется, я не могу найти, какова реальная разница между...

151
boundingRectWithSize для NSAttributedString, возвращающий неправильный размер

Я пытаюсь получить прямоугольник для приписанной строки, но вызов boundingRectWithSize не учитывает размер, который я передаю, и возвращает прямоугольник с высотой в одну строку в отличие от большой высоты (это длинная строка). Я экспериментировал, передавая очень большое значение для высоты, а...

151
Как разбить строку и присвоить ее переменным

В Python можно разбить строку и назначить ее переменным: ip, port = '127.0.0.1:5432'.split(':') но в Go это, похоже, не работает: ip, port := strings.Split("127.0.0.1:5432", ":") // assignment count mismatch: 2 = 1 Вопрос: Как разбить строку и присвоить значения за один...

150
Как объединить несколько строк C ++ в одну строку?

C # имеет функцию синтаксиса, где вы можете объединить много типов данных в одну строку. string s = new String(); s += "Hello world, " + myInt + niceToSeeYouString; s += someChar1 + interestingDecimal + someChar2; Что было бы эквивалентно в C ++? Насколько я вижу, вам придется делать все это в...

150
Удалить символы после определенного символа в строке, а затем удалить подстроку?

Я чувствую себя глупым, когда публикую это, когда это кажется простым и есть множество вопросов по строкам / символам / регулярным выражениям, но я не смог найти то, что мне нужно (кроме как на другом языке: Удалить весь текст после определенной точки ). У меня есть такой код: [Test] public void...

150
Удалить нечисловые символы (кроме точек и запятых) из строки

Если у меня есть следующие значения: $var1 = AR3,373.31 $var2 = 12.322,11T Как я могу создать новую переменную и установить для нее копию данных, в которой удалены все нечисловые символы, за исключением запятых и точек? Приведенные выше значения будут возвращать следующие результаты: $var1_copy =...

150
Получить значения URL параметров строки запроса с помощью jQuery / Javascript (querystring)

Кто-нибудь знает хороший способ написать расширение jQuery для обработки параметров строки запроса? Я в основном хочу расширить магическую ($)функцию jQuery, чтобы я мог сделать что-то вроде этого: $('?search').val(); Что бы дать мне значение «тест» в следующем URL:...

150
Объясните использование битового вектора для определения того, являются ли все символы уникальными

Я не понимаю, как будет работать битовый вектор (не слишком знаком с битовыми векторами). Вот код, данный. Может кто-нибудь, пожалуйста, проведите меня через это? public static boolean isUniqueChars(String str) { int checker = 0; for (int i = 0; i < str.length(); ++i) { int val = str.charAt(i) -...

150
Как получить все за определенного персонажа?

У меня есть строка, и я хотел бы получить все после определенного значения. Строка всегда начинается с набора цифр, а затем подчеркивания. Я хотел бы получить оставшуюся часть строки после символа подчеркивания. Так, например, если у меня есть следующие строки и то, что я хотел бы вернуть:...

148
Каков наиболее эффективный метод конкатенации строк в python?

Есть ли эффективный массовый метод конкатенации строк в Python (например, StringBuilder в C # или StringBuffer в Java)? Я нашел следующие методы здесь : Простое объединение с использованием + Использование списка строк и joinметода Использование UserStringиз MutableStringмодуля Использование...

148
Удалить строку из начала строки

У меня есть строка, которая выглядит так: $str = "bla_string_bla_bla_bla"; Как удалить первую bla_; но только если он находится в начале строки? С str_replace(), он удаляет все bla_ ....